Product description

This advanced fully automatic three-stage 30 Amp battery charger is ideal for charging all types of 12 Volt lead-acid batteries ( Flooded / Absorbed Glass Mat (AGM) / Gel Cell) from a 120 V, 60 Hz or 230 V, 50 Hz AC source. By means of a DIP switch setting, conversion to a two-stage algorithm is possible to charge batteries connected to a DC load (DC UPS). The unit can also be used as a DC Power Supply. Features include overload, short-circuit and over-temperature protection. The unit allows charging of up-to 3 separate battery banks.

  • 2 or 3 Stage charging (user selectable).
  • 120 or 230 VAC, 50/60 Hz (user selectable).
  • Voltage meter display Ammeter and LED power status.
  • For all types of Lead Acid batteries.
  • Charge with a battery load or stand alone.
  • Use as a power supply or DC UPS.
  • UPC: Universal Protection Circuit short circuit, overload, reverse battery polarity.
  • Charge 3 banks of batteries at once no isolator necessary.
  • Input: 120 VAC 60 Hz or 230 VAC 50 Hz.
  • Output: 12 VDC.
  • Amps: 30 Amps.
  • Dimensions: 10.5" x 8.5" x 3".
  • Safety: Listed to UL Standard UL-1564, EMI Compliant to FCC Part 15(B), Class B.
